We have a strong commitment to environmental sustainability in how we operate our business, and we hold ourselves accountable to clear and measurable objectives. For example, in 2020, we established a 2025 carbon removal goal – previously referred to as our 2025 net-zero emissions goal – and we are on track to achieve this goal. During fiscal 2024, we received approval from the Science Based Targets initiative (SBTi) for net-zero greenhouse gas (GHG) emissions targets aligned with SBTi’s Corporate Net-Zero Standard, including new, near-term and long-term reduction targets. We continue to work toward our 2025 carbon removal goal by first focusing on reductions across our Scope 1, 2, and 3 emissions and then removing any remaining emissions through nature-based carbon removal projects. At the end of fiscal 2024, our nature-based carbon removal portfolio included projects in Indonesia, the Philippines, the United Kingdom and the United States (outside the state of California). Carbon credits were not applied to offset any of our total reported emissions for fiscal 2024.
